What is a Junior BIM Developer?

Junior BIM Developers are entry-level professionals who assist in creating, managing, and maintaining Building Information Modeling (BIM) data and digital models for construction projects. They typically use software like Autodesk Revit, Navisworks, or similar tools to support the design, visualization, and coordination of building systems. Their role involves collaborating with architects, engineers, and other stakeholders to ensure accurate and up-to-date digital representations of buildings. Junior BIM Developers often help automate repetitive tasks, develop custom scripts, and troubleshoot BIM issues under the guidance of more experienced team members.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Junior BIM Developer?

To thrive as a Junior BIM Developer, you need a foundational understanding of building information modeling concepts, construction or architectural knowledge, and often a degree in engineering, architecture, or a related field. Familiarity with BIM software such as Autodesk Revit, Navisworks, and AutoCAD, as well as basic programming or scripting (e.g., Dynamo, Python), is commonly required. Strong attention to detail, problem-solving abilities, and effective communication help you collaborate with multidisciplinary teams and adapt to evolving project needs. These skills ensure accurate digital model creation, efficient project coordination, and overall success in delivering high-quality construction outcomes.

What are some common challenges faced by Junior BIM Developers when transitioning from academia to industry?

Junior BIM Developers often find that applying academic knowledge to real-world projects can be challenging, especially when adapting to specific company workflows, project deadlines, and industry-standard software tools. Working within multidisciplinary teams also requires strong communication skills to collaborate effectively with architects, engineers, and contractors. Additionally, learning to manage multiple tasks, prioritize deliverables, and troubleshoot software or model issues independently are important skills that develop with hands-on experience and mentorship.

What is the difference between Junior Bim Developer vs Junior Revit Technician?

AspectJunior Bim DeveloperJunior Revit Technician
Required CredentialsBasic knowledge of BIM software, some certificationsProficiency in Revit, often with related certifications
Work EnvironmentDesign firms, architecture, and engineering companiesArchitectural and engineering firms, construction companies
Industry UsageUsed for BIM modeling, data management, and developmentFocused on creating and managing Revit models and drawings
Common Search/ComparisonOften compared for entry-level BIM rolesCompared for technical Revit support roles

The comparison shows that Junior Bim Developers and Junior Revit Technicians share similar entry-level requirements and work environments within architecture and engineering industries. While Junior Bim Developers focus on BIM software development and data integration, Junior Revit Technicians primarily handle Revit modeling and drafting tasks. Both roles are essential in BIM workflows, but they differ in scope and technical focus.
